About Deichgraf
The church forms the center of your village. In its vicinity you have to build everything your village needs. In order to put these construction projects into practice, raw materials are needed. The lumberjack provides you with wood at regular intervals, the farm produces food and houses will get you thalers. Be warned, however, each of these buildings also consumes certain materials. In order to be well prepared in the fight against the water, it is advisable to protect the village with various defense mechanisms. For example, dikes and low-lift pumps which can keep the approaching water at bay or transport it away from your village.
Storm surges and heavy rain are omnipresent! The construction of dikes can help keep the water outside of your village, but against the rain they are powerless. To protect the village from heavy rain you have the possibility to use Siels, pumps and ditches to drain excess water. With this procedure you are able to dry out flooded buildings and production can proceed.
As a Dike Warden in East Frisia in the 16th century, it is up to you to prove your skills in many different scenarios! Each of these scenarios presents you with different challenges and will try to force you to your knees by all means. You will have to adjust to these new situations to get the upper hand in the fight against the water. Long live the Dike Warden!Features:

[h1] Fight against the water [/h1] https://steamcommunity.com/sharedfiles/filedetails/?id=2824054561 [h1] STORY [/h1] Missing. Although, as far as I understand, there are some historical analogies with real events in the Netherlands. [h1] GAMEPLAY [/h1] The gameplay is a city-building game where the only task is to save your settlement from the advancing water element. We extract resources: gold, wood and food. We build our settlement and defense structures for them. The game is divided into several levels, on each of which you need to complete the corresponding tasks. With each stage, the water comes more and more. https://steamcommunity.com/sharedfiles/filedetails/?id=2824054871 Consider the pros and cons of the game, sum up. [h1] PROS: [/h1] + Simple but nice graphics. + Good music and sound accompaniment. Classical music plays in the background. + Pleasant city building, 5 types of buildings and three types of resources. [h1] CONS: [/h1] - Not enough content. [h1] CONCLUSIONS [/h1] Nice little city building game. Not to say that this is something outstanding, but not bad either. There is more good than bad, so I give it a positive rating. It's a great core concept, but the game feels and plays more like an unfinished indie free-to-play experiment. Loading a saved game messes up all of your building entrances so they point South. Water seeps under walls. There is no pause functionality.
